Necessary To My World Poem by Jim Boone

Necessary To My World



There you are
Just when I need you
Happy to hear your voice,
I s m i l e

Accepting always
My chameleon-like moods
Necessary to my world
You and your style.

Kindred spirits
Dodging potholes
Down the avenue
Hand in hand
Our senses inflated
To a natural high

Verbalizing energies
We share
Feeling immune
To inane beliefs
That others let slip by

Nurturing a kinship
That sustains and will
Never, ever die.
1968
